Description

Serves as the Community Action Agency for the county. Purpose is to alleviate the effects and causes of poverty through a variety of programs that serve low-income families, children, and older adults. Generally, programs address unemployment, inadequate housing and utilities, poor nutrition and health, and the lack of educational opportunities in the community.

Providing organization

Ironton-Lawrence County Community Action Organization

Provides supportive services for the low-income population of Lawrence County. Offers HEAP for utility bill payment assistance, WIC for mothers and their babies, the Home Weatherization Program, and serves as grantee/delegate agency for Head Start.
